Output 249a72d9695cd324c7aef18fc24b694c3cc937763a97f94b170cdb6d2530e947:1

value
308031476
script pubkey
OP_0 OP_PUSHBYTES_20 26d0c00a2b9e238cf13439af0bd47e5da8e7120e
address
ltc1qymgvqz3tnc3ceuf58xhsh4r7tk5wwyswcxxswd
transaction
249a72d9695cd324c7aef18fc24b694c3cc937763a97f94b170cdb6d2530e947
spent
true